Lunukin mo ‘yung germs na inubo mo! Sanitize, practice cough etiquette, Duterte tells public

By Prince Golez

President Rodrigo Duterte urged the public to observe proper cough etiquette to prevent the transmission of the coronavirus disease.

Late Tuesday, Duterte asked people to cover their mouths with a handkerchief when coughing.

“Pakiusap ako sa labas, sundin lang po ninyo ‘yung masks at saka ‘yung pag-ubo, magdala ka, magbili kayo ng panyo maski ‘yang murahin lang tapos try to cover, kung may sipon ka o ubo ka, try to cover your mouth bago ka…,” the President said during his pre-recorded public address.

“At saka medyo patagalin mo nang kaunti, ‘wag mo kaagad… Siguro mabuti niyan lunukin mo ‘yung germs na inubo mo para — swallow it back so that it will not contaminate others,” he also said.

To protect against the disease, Duterte also advised everyone to clean hands with alcohol-based handrubs.

“Every time that you feel like touching something or maski ano — wala mang handshaking, ba-bye, ba-bye man lang. Kung mag-galaw-galaw ka, before you touch your nose, eyes, mag-alcohol ka muna. Of course, it will dry your hands but that’s only temporary,” according to him.
